ALL SUPPORTING DOCUMENTS inc photocopies of Vfs application form and nig pass (not original) are submitted in Sheffield . vfs ikeja will only accept tb test application form and passport at least as of August ... This applies if it is for settlement visa and d sponsor lives in UK. All documents are now accepted by Sheffield home office . Vfs will only accept the original tb certificate and the Vfs application form and of coz ur passport .thanks @whales1212. I also questioned the people that r using £60-£80 to send the supporting docs to Sheffield . I wondered if they r using Amazon drone or personal jet. U can send it with Royal Mail guaranteed to be delivered by 1pm and u can track ur parcel in realtime up until it is received ... So up to u . Lastly don't forget the SAE FOR THE DOCUMENTS to be returned once the valuation is complete . MrsAdebiyi:Dear all Happy to inform my husband got his passport back today . thanks to @Whales1212, Ikato3540 @girlfio @bassy101113@justwise and others for all their contribution. This forum has been very helpful to me , albeit for a short period , but at least it calmed my fears and gave me information. So incase anyone is interested below is my timeline and supporting documents submitted. Application submitted 30/07/2014 Biometrics : 01/08/2014 Supporting docs submitted : 12/08/14 supporting docs returned :15/10/2014 Passport collected:22/10/2014 Supporting docs 1. Copy of my British e-Passport 2. Marriage Certificate 3. my Proof of Employment 4. 6 Months Bank Statements 5. Tenancy agreement 6. Marriage certificate from church & registry 7. Utility & Council tax bill 8. 6 Months payslips 9. Savings balance from bank 10. Proof of communication with my husband - phone log, emails, Whatsapp) 11. Copies of Photographs from our Court Wedding, Traditional Wedding and older pictures during our holiday 12. IELTS certificate for my husband 13. Photocopy of my husband's master's degree certificate 14. Photocopy of my husband's staff identity card 15. Photocopy of my husband's order and confirmation of appointment 16. Copies of my husband's payslips 17. Photocopy of TB certificate 18. Photocopy of my husband's Birth certificate and Nigerian Passport 19. Original copy of my husband's bank statements 21. A copy of our wedding programme & Invitation card. All the best to our current and future applicants !! ![]() |

With regards to supporting documents it should be returned to the UK address and possibly "signed for" at least that was how I received mine . And since you provided a UK sae return envelope it is unlikely Home office will send the supporting docs to Nigeria unfortunately they are not that rich. Best if u Ask ur partner if he (or she) has received it by Royal Mail special delivery ! You really shud have received ur documents by by now I applied after u and I have received mine . Alternatively email Sheffield to find out . Best if u use their email us form on the UKVI page rather than the email address... |
